Subject: DR drill — nightly reindex cutover

Support team,

Tomorrow's disaster-recovery drill at Marrowgate will fail over the nightly search reindex from the primary cluster to the standby in Veldoria. Expect stale search results for up to two hours; log any customer reports under the drill tag, not as incidents. If the standby indexer prompts for manual unlock during cutover, the operator should enter the recovery passphrase shown immediately below.

vault phrase of tajeg-tageg = pelix-druix-holius-briael-zorwyn-frawyn-fraox-norok-drueth-aldiel

## Migration to Flowkit — plugin authors

Cron-based plugins are deprecated in Nimbrella 4.2. Port schedules to Flowkit workflow specs before the freeze. Steps: convert crontab lines to `schedule:` blocks, drop any in-process locking (Flowkit serializes runs), and re-register triggers via the plugin manifest. Retries default to three; override in the spec, not code. Legacy cron entries are purged at cutover. All submitted workflow bundles must be signed before the registry accepts them. Sign your bundle with the key below.

signing key of bagap-yawep = bky13_TbfT6ZMUoGJo2

## Escalation: Flaky DNS Resolution

Intermittent DNS failures in the Cobbleton cluster usually trace back to the caching resolver on the edge nodes dropping entries under load. First restart the resolver service and confirm lookups recover within five minutes. If failures persist or spread to other zones, escalate to the Network Platform on-call rotation. Document affected hostnames and timestamps before escalating. For recurring patterns or resolver configuration changes, contact the network team at the address below.

alerts address for bawif-hahig: norwyn_gorys_lamath@olvarqlabs.test